Q. Of the following taxonomic categories which is the most inclusive (i.e. is the highest in hierarchy)?

  • (A) Order
  • (B) Subspecies
  • (C) Class
  • (D) Genus
βœ… Correct Answer: (C) Class

The taxonomic hierarchy (from most inclusive to least inclusive) is:

  1. Kingdom (Most inclusive)
  2. Phylum/Division
  3. Class ← (Correct Answer, as it is the highest among the given options)
  4. Order
  5. Family
  6. Genus
  7. Species
  8. Subspecies (Least inclusive)

Since Class is higher in rank than Order, Genus, and Subspecies, it is the most inclusive among the given options.
